Letters of John Marin is a collection of personal letters written by the renowned American artist John Marin. The book provides an intimate look into the life and thoughts of Marin, as he writes to friends, family, and fellow artists. The letters cover a wide range of topics, including Marin's artistic process, his travels, his relationships, and his opinions on the art world of his time. The book also includes a number of illustrations, including sketches and drawings by Marin himself.
